Linux was developed by Dennis Ritchie, who wanted to create an operating system to maximize the limited capabilities of the Inte
Ivenika [448]

Answer:

B) False

Explanation:

Linux was developed by Linus Torvalds, a Finnish student. Linus started developing Linux as a personal project in the year 1991. Linux was created so that it could be an alternative to the then used operating system, MS-DOS and could be used free. Linus created Linux so that he could use his computer with more easily and with very less restrictions. However Linux is a kernel.
